    The blacklist.cfg file is wrecked whenever the file is written to by the server. For example:

    If you add a player to the file then the reason will be automatically overwritten to "Banned" if the game ever modifies the file. You can replicate this bug by adding someone to the file, loading the security in game, and then waiting for the game to ping ban someone (you could probably try adding a ban ingame to achieve the same effect).

    This means it's difficult to keep track of why someone was actually banned and makes it even harder to point them to a place they can appeal. Please fix this soon.
